Holding More: The Real Skill of Leadership Most women are taught that growth requires doing more. More effort. More productivity. More responsibility. And for a while, that works. But eventually leadership stops being about how much you can do — and starts becoming about how much you can hold. The decisions. The uncertainty. The expectations. The visibility. In this episode, we explore the difference between doing more and holding more, and why nervous system capacity becomes the real foundation of sustainable leadership. Because when your nervous system is constantly braced, even success can start to feel heavy. Not because you're incapable. But because responsibility without regulation becomes exhausting. This conversation unpacks why leadership pressure often activates subtle nervous system bracing, how that affects decision-making and visibility, and why expanding your internal capacity changes the entire experience of leading. If leadership has begun to feel heavier than expected, this episode will help you understand why — and what actually creates steadiness. In This Episode • The difference between doing more vs. holding more • Why leadership pressure activates nervous system bracing • The invisible tension many high-achieving women carry • How responsibility can feel destabilizing even when things are going well • Why regulation changes the way leadership feels • What sustainable expansion actually requires Key Reframes Leadership isn’t about doing more. It’s about holding more without bracing. Responsibility doesn’t create pressure. Nervous system tension does. A regulated leader doesn’t eliminate uncertainty. She expands her capacity to hold it.
